The COPD Score in 04556, Edgecomb, Maine is 99 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
83.05 percent of the population in 04556 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 80.40 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 3.84 percent of the residents in 04556 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.79 members with about 2.33 cars available per household.
An estimate of 91.29 percent of the residents in 04556 has some form of health insurance. 33.23 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 75.56 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 04556 would have to travel an average of 6.41 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Lincolnhealth .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 04556, Edgecomb, Maine.

As of , an estimate of 1,252 residents live in 04556 with a median age of 51.6 years. 11.66 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 26.12 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 44.91 percent of the residents in 04556 is currently married, and 13.19 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 04556 is $8,203.17.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 04556 is approximately $1,239. The median household spends about 15.10 percent of their income on housing.

COPD, or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ease, is a chronic inflammatory lung disease that causes obstructed airflow from the lungs. This condition can make breathing difficult and often requires ongoing medical care and support.
